Changing tires? Can I switch 700 x 35 to 700 x anything?

I have a 7.1 fx with Bontrager H2 tires and I think they are 700x35. Can I switch Schwabe Kojack 700x26 or is there something I should look for on my bike's specs/rim that would show me a limit?

I put 26MM tires on my 20MM wide hybrid rims and they function fine.
I wouldn't recommend going under 25MM though.

I mounted a 23MM just for grins and externally, the tire is narrower than the rim sidewalls.

I once ordered a pair of 28mm Gatorskins and put them on 23mm Synergy rims, then on to the new bike I was building. Something just didn't look right. Close examination revealed that while the removable tags of both tires said "28mm", one tire had "23mm" molded into the sidewall. I was surprised it didn't look worse, but since then Velocity has introduced the A23 for 23mm tires which is the same width as the Synergy.

I returned the 23 for another 28.
